First off, I am not in good enough health to help her nor do I have any experience with fishers. To date she has one cat injured and two cats killed inside the barn. The cats are barn cats and she feeds them 2X daily, and at night most of the cats stay in the barn. She read (googled I think) that a fisher makes a circuit of 2-3 weeks, she is convinced a fisher is getting after her cats. It seems to catch by back legs while they are sleeping among hay bales. The time between the first attack and the second attack was a month, in between those attacks our neighbor lost a cat (missing). It was 3 weeks between the 2nd attack and the 3rd attack. She is using cage traps and thus far has caught 2 coon and an opossum. The last cat was killed after catching the coons. She read somewhere that if you can't catch the fisher you should scare it away. The way they suggested you scare it away is to use coyote or bobcat lure. When I heard that I had to laugh, but she believes it. She wanted me to ask the experts so let me know your thoughts.

Have her take pics of the tracks in the snow around the barn...to see if it is a fisher

Also a long picture of the line of tracks...to see the gait...of said critter.

Probably have to keep at least 3 cages working.

Bait them with beaver meat...and some Gusto on a rag suspended over the trap..

Cover that trap with hemlock bows...to make a cozy cubbie type of set.

I can see a big feral tom cat also. If the critter returns you can get pictures. Using coyote lure might not scare a fisher away. I have caught many fisher in coyote sets with coyote lure.
